Fiction & Non-Fiction Books
Shop by category
Shop by genre
New releases, best-sellers & pre-orders
36,193,760 results
Sort: Best match
- £19.99Free international postageClick & CollectOnly 3 left
- £18.99Was: £55.93was - £55.93Free international postageClick & Collect
- Brand new£10.79£2.99 P&PClick & Collect79 sold
- £16.95 to £27.95Free international postageClick & Collect
- £4.99 to £120.99Free international postage
- £3.65Free international postageOnly 2 left
- £3.52Free international postageOnly 2 left
- £0.99£0.99 P&P35 sold
- £35.99Free international postageClick & Collect166 sold
- £4.99 to £12.99Free international postage
- £33.85Free international postageClick & Collect109 sold
- Brand new£18.00Was: £22.00was - £22.00Free international postage29 sold
- £19.74Was: £25.00was - £25.00Free international postage
- £43.49Was: £77.94was - £77.94Free international postageClick & Collect
- £27.99 to £31.99Free international postageClick & Collect437 sold
- £35.99Free international postageClick & Collect
- £19.99Free international postageClick & Collect91 sold
- £3.65Free international postage517 sold
- £2.88Free international postage1,758 sold
- £3.25Free international postageOnly 3 left
- £3.10Free international postage200 sold
- £3.65Free international postage1,810 sold
- £9.85Was: £9.99was - £9.99Free international postageOnly 2 left
- £2.88Free international postage1,581 sold
- £2.77Free international postage
- £29.99Free international postageClick & Collect101 sold
- £13.10Was: £14.99was - £14.99Free international postage197 sold
- Brand new£13.29Was: £14.99was - £14.99Free international postage
- £21.00Was: £28.00was - £28.00Free international postage24 sold
- £16.99Free international postageClick & Collect1,228 sold
- £15.95£3.50 P&PClick & Collect
- £14.99Was: £39.95was - £39.95Free international postageClick & Collect87 sold
- £6.75Free international postage58 sold
- £12.82Was: £16.95was - £16.95Free international postage12 watching
- £24.99Was: £39.95was - £39.95Free international postageClick & Collect
- £2.94Free international postage108 sold
- £15.99Free international postageClick & Collect206 sold
- £7.49Free international postageClick & Collect
- £21.99Was: £83.88was - £83.88Free international postageClick & Collect
- £12.99Was: £59.88was - £59.88Free international postageClick & Collect
- £3.68Free international postageOnly 2 left
- £3.53Free international postageOnly 3 left
- £3.10Free international postage721 sold
- £8.83Was: £9.99was - £9.99Free international postageOnly 1 left.
- £10.85Was: £10.99was - £10.99Free international postage403 sold
- £99.99Free international postageClick & Collect139 sold
- £3.42Free international postage254 sold
- £6.05Free international postage683 sold
- £9.99Was: £10.99was - £10.99Free international postageOnly 2 left
- £6.99Free international postage
- £2.88Free international postage1,977 sold
- £19.95Was: £25.00was - £25.00Free international postage6 watching
- Brand new£9.50Free international postageClick & Collect
- £7.94Free international postageClick & Collect203 sold
- £9.35Was: £9.99was - £9.99Free international postageClick & CollectOnly 2 left
- £8.99Free international postageClick & Collect
- £26.99Free international postageClick & Collect
- £3.53Free international postage1,054 sold
- £13.99Was: £23.97was - £23.97Free international postageClick & Collect
- £10.80or Best Offer£2.10 P&P












